I was diagnosed with herpes 2 days ago, this is the first std I've ever had and its also the most painful thing my body is experiencing. The day I was diagnosed my area was so swollen and sore but no sores however no they are fully blown open sores that i feel like are never going to heal. Sometime i can hardly walk or get up and down the stairs the pain is so great. Since the first day I have been on antivirals and paracetamols, I've been taking salt baths but its still so painful. There is also quite a bit of watery discharge as well which I'm constantly trying to clean away to keep the area dry and not sticky however this does not help at night. It becomes so painful in the morning. I've read that i can try putting baking soda on the sores to help relieve the pain and dry out the sores so they heal quicker, but i think this is going to sting like a bitch and its something id rather like to avoid. Would i be okay applying vaseline or would that affect the healing process?

Any advice for pain relief and removal of the sores would be greatly appreciated thank you XX
